About
Koen Langendoen is a leading researcher in wireless sensor networks (WSNs), mobile ad-hoc networks, and distributed computing. His work focuses on enabling autonomous systems to collaboratively sense, compute, and act upon environmental data. A key contribution is his research on distributed computation of information potentials, where he developed methods for mobile nodes to extract and process process information without centralized control—a fundamental challenge in robotic swarms and network coordination. This 2012 paper, with 9 citations, provides a theoretical foundation for tasks like search and surveillance in dynamic environments. Langendoen also innovated in sensor-augmented pose estimation, proposing an inside-out camera tracking system that uses LED sightings from wireless sensor nodes to determine position and orientation. This 2010 work, cited 4 times, bridges WSNs with augmented reality and robotics, offering a low-cost, radio-controlled alternative to traditional visual markers. His contributions are notable for their practical impact on distributed intelligence, enabling networks of simple devices to perform complex, coordinated tasks. Langendoen’s research continues to influence the design of scalable, energy-efficient systems for environmental monitoring, localization, and autonomous navigation.
